Compartilhar via


Classe StorageManagementClient

 

Representa um cliente de gerenciamento de serviço de armazenamento.

Namespace:   Microsoft.WindowsAzure.Management.Storage
Assembly:  Microsoft.WindowsAzure.Management.Storage (em Microsoft.WindowsAzure.Management.Storage.dll)

Hierarquia de herança

System.Object
  Hyak.Common.ServiceClient<T>
    Microsoft.WindowsAzure.Management.Storage.StorageManagementClient

Sintaxe

public class StorageManagementClient : ServiceClient<StorageManagementClient>, 
    IStorageManagementClient, IDisposable
public ref class StorageManagementClient : ServiceClient<StorageManagementClient^>, 
    IStorageManagementClient, IDisposable
type StorageManagementClient = 
    class
        inherit ServiceClient<StorageManagementClient>
        interface IStorageManagementClient
        interface IDisposable
    end
Public Class StorageManagementClient
    Inherits ServiceClient(Of StorageManagementClient)
    Implements IStorageManagementClient, IDisposable

Construtores

Nome Descrição
StorageManagementClient()

Inicializa uma nova instância da classe StorageManagementClient.

StorageManagementClient(HttpClient)

Inicializa uma nova instância da classe StorageManagementClient.

StorageManagementClient(SubscriptionCloudCredentials)

Inicializa uma nova instância da classe StorageManagementClient.

StorageManagementClient(SubscriptionCloudCredentials, HttpClient)

Inicializa uma nova instância da classe StorageManagementClient.

StorageManagementClient(SubscriptionCloudCredentials, Uri)

Inicializa uma nova instância da classe StorageManagementClient.

StorageManagementClient(SubscriptionCloudCredentials, Uri, HttpClient)

Inicializa uma nova instância da classe StorageManagementClient.

Propriedades

Nome Descrição
ApiVersion

Obtém a versão de API.

BaseUri

Obtém ou define o URI que é usado como base para todas as solicitações de gerenciamento de serviços.

Credentials

Obtém ou define um SubscriptionCloudCredentials objeto que especifica as credenciais de assinatura.

HttpClient

(herdado de ServiceClient<T>.)

HttpMessageHandler

(herdado de ServiceClient<T>.)

LongRunningOperationInitialTimeout

Obtém ou define o tempo limite inicial para operações de execução longa.

LongRunningOperationRetryTimeout

Obtém ou define o tempo limite de repetições para operações de execução longa.

StorageAccounts

Obtém as contas de armazenamento.

UserAgent

(herdado de ServiceClient<T>.)

Métodos

Nome Descrição
AddHandlerToPipeline(DelegatingHandler)

(herdado de ServiceClient<T>.)

Clone(ServiceClient<StorageManagementClient>)

Propriedades de clones da instância atual para outra instância de StorageManagementClient(Substitui ServiceClient<T>.Clone(ServiceClient<T>).)

Dispose()

(herdado de ServiceClient<T>.)

Equals(Object)

(herdado de Object.)

Finalize()

(herdado de Object.)

GetHashCode()

(herdado de Object.)

GetHttpPipeline()

(herdado de ServiceClient<T>.)

GetOperationStatusAsync(String, CancellationToken)

Recuperação do status de uma operação assíncrona.

GetType()

(herdado de Object.)

InitializeHttpClient(HttpMessageHandler)

(herdado de ServiceClient<T>.)

MemberwiseClone()

(herdado de Object.)

SetRetryPolicy(RetryPolicy)

(herdado de ServiceClient<T>.)

ToString()

(herdado de Object.)

WithHandler(DelegatingHandler)

(herdado de ServiceClient<T>.)

WithHandler(ServiceClient<T>, DelegatingHandler)

(herdado de ServiceClient<T>.)

WithHandlers(IEnumerable<DelegatingHandler>)

(herdado de ServiceClient<T>.)

Métodos de Extensão

Nome Descrição
GetOperationStatus(String)

Recupera o status de uma operação.(Definido por StorageManagementClientExtensions.)

GetOperationStatusAsync(String)

Recuperação do status de uma operação assíncrona.(Definido por StorageManagementClientExtensions.)

Acesso thread-safe

Qualquer estático público (Compartilhado no Visual Basic) membros desde tipo são thread safe. Não há garantia de que qualquer membro de instância seja thread-safe.

Consulte também

Namespace Microsoft.WindowsAzure.Management.Storage

Retornar ao topo